Guidance on engagement with Indigenous Peoples, Local Communities and affected stakeholders
Detalles
Meaningful engagement with Indigenous Peoples and Local Communities and affected stakeholders is a critical part of any organization's identification and assessment of nature-related issues. This document provides guidance to organizations in identifying their nature-related dependencies, impacts, risks, and opportunities. It outlines the foundations of international standards, guidelines and frameworks, in particular the UN Guiding Principles on Business and Human Rights.
